Comprehending the Ignition Switch
The ignition turn on a vehicle is responsible for beginning the engine when the key is turned. It connects the battery to the ignition system and provides power to vital electrical components. To understand the repair procedure, it is vital to understand how the ignition switch functions.

Recognizing the signs of a failing ignition switch is vital for timely repair. Here are some common indications that may suggest an ignition switch issue:

Key Won't Turn
The most obvious sign is that the key won't rotate in the ignition. This could be due to a damaged switch or a worn-out key.

Intermittent Power
If the control panel lights flicker and the car sometimes shuts off while driving, this might be a sign of an ignition switch malfunction.

Warning Lights
Certain warning lights might flash on the dashboard due to electrical connectivity problems linked to the ignition switch.

No Start Condition
When the ignition key is turned, there might be no reaction from the vehicle, indicating that the switch isn't engaging.

Battery Issues
If the battery is functioning generally however the vehicle still won't start, the ignition switch might be at fault.

If you've determined that the ignition switch is the source of your vehicle's problems, you might be able to repair it yourself. Here's a step-by-step guide to carrying out ignition switch repair.
Tools NeededScrewdrivers (flat-head and Phillips)Socket set or wrench setReplacement ignition switch (if needed)Safety glovesMultimeterRepair Process
Preparation
Guarantee that you have all tools and parts ready. Disconnect the car battery before beginning any repair.

Gain Access To the Ignition Switch
Utilize the suitable screwdriver or socket wrench to eliminate the steering column cover. This will allow access to the ignition switch.

Check the Ignition Switch
Examine the switch for any visible indications of wear or damage. Inspect electrical ports for corrosion or loose wires.

Test the Ignition Switch
Utilizing a multimeter, test the connection of the ignition switch. If it fails the test, replacement will be necessary.

Change the Ignition Switch
If repairs are not feasible, utilize the new ignition switch to change the malfunctioning one. Follow all actions in reverse to reassemble the steering column.

Reconnect the Battery
As soon as you've finished the installation, reconnect the battery and test the ignition key to ensure it starts the engine.
